Les Arcs is a wonderful, modern resort filled with inspiring skiing. Now linked to La Plagne, the "Paradiski" area offers a massive 425 kms of pistes and has a superb snow record. Exhilarating runs swoop through the forests, providing wonderful skiing at all levels which is superb for all grades of skier or snowboarder.
Les Arcs comprises 4 self-contained villages at different heights: Arc 1800, home to the ever popular & highly recommended Hotel Du Golf Les Arcs, is the largest village, with a lively atmosphere, good selection of shops and restaurants plus excellent access to the skiing. Arc 2000 is popular with experienced skiers, with skiing to and from the doorstep and near the magnificent Aiguille Rouge glacier. Arc 1600 nestles below the other two and has a real village atmosphere. Arc 1950 is the new stunning village built in a traditional style with many luxury accommodations , Nearby Peisey-Vallandry is closest to la Plagne so has quick access to the whole ski area.

Après Ski: Good après ski in Arc 1800 with some regular live music venues Recommended are the JO bar, Red Hot Saloon, Chez Boubou and the jazz bar in the Du Golf. Arc 1600 is quieter but the Abreuvoir is worth a visit as is the friendly Chez Fernand. In Arc 2000, there is the El Latir for live music, plus the Whistler's Dream. At 1950, there are several bars including the O'Chaud and the Belles Pintes.
Activities: Parapenting, floodlit skiing (1600,1800 and 2000), ice rink (1800 and 2000), ski biking, spa facilities at 1950, bowling at 1800.
Eating Out ; Like the Apres-ski, there is more choice in Arc 1800 where there are around 15 restaurants. Recomended are the Mountain cafe and San Diego. Arc 1600 have a few excellent places like the Malouine and the Cairn. In Arc 2000, the Kilimandjaro is popular or the Chez Eux for gastronomic meals, Arc 1950 has a resonable choice for a fairly small resorts.
Other Amenities: Shops, cinema, supermarkets, banks (1800), 25kms of prepared walking paths, shopping in Bourg St Maurice.
